Defining OOTB vs Customizations

robynsah1
Kilo Explorer

We have several new developers that seek to have some guidelines as to what is considered out of the box functionality in Instanbul/Jaskarta versus what would be considered customization. We are trying to assist with defining this and putting process around our current developement methodology. Does anyone know or attempting to document?

5 REPLIES 5

The SN Nerd
Giga Sage
Giga Sage

These days I use the points below as a guideline to what is customization:

  • Deviation from the State Flow as defined in Process Guides

  • Modification to existing functionality

It's not just about wether something is a customisation or not. Other considerations include:

  • When "extending the platform", is the feature you are developing on the roadmap for release by ServiceNow in future versions? 
  • When "customizing", is the artefact you are customizing likely to be upgraded in future?

 


ServiceNow Nerd
ServiceNow Developer MVP 2020-2022
ServiceNow Community MVP 2019-2022